Our '03 4-cyl LX is NOT drive-by-wire. Probably true for all 4cyl, 7th-gen. I think the V-6 is dbw, but I'm not sure.

BTW, drive-by-wire doesn't mean there's no throttle cable. Our '01 Saab is dbw, and there is a normal-looking throttle cable. But the cable drum isn't connected to the throttle shaft. There's a positioner or stepper motor in between. That way it can lock itself together when it goes into limp-home mode.
